🎥 Статьи

Для чего нужен запрос в 1С

В мире 1С, где царствуют данные, запросы — это ваши верные рыцари, готовые извлечь любую информацию из глубин базы данных. ⚔️ Представьте себе огромную библиотеку, где хранится всё знание мира, но без каталога. Запросы — это и есть тот самый каталог, позволяющий найти нужную книгу, не перебирая все тома вручную. 📚

  1. Зачем нужны запросы в 1С? 🤔
  2. Виды запросов: от простого к сложному 🔨
  3. Консоль запросов: ваш полигон для экспериментов 🧪
  4. Язык запросов 1С: разговор с базой данных на «ты» 🗣️
  5. План запроса: заглядываем под капот ⚙️
  6. & vs &&: в чем разница? 🤔
  7. Заключение: запросы — ваш ключ к успеху в мире 1С 🏆
  8. FAQ: часто задаваемые вопросы о запросах в 1С ❓

Зачем нужны запросы в 1С? 🤔

Запросы в 1С — это не просто способ «достать» информацию. Это мощный инструмент, который позволяет:

  • Выбирать данные по заданным критериям: нужны продажи за определенный период? Не проблема! Хотите узнать, какие товары пользуются наибольшим спросом? Запрос вам в помощь! 📈
  • Обрабатывать информацию: сгруппировать данные по нужному признаку, отсортировать по возрастанию или убыванию, рассчитать суммы, средние значения и многое другое — всё это под силу запросам. 🧮
  • Формировать отчеты: запросы — это фундамент для создания любых отчетов в 1С. 📊

Виды запросов: от простого к сложному 🔨

1С предоставляет разработчикам и пользователям богатый арсенал инструментов для работы с запросами:

  • Простые запросы: идеальный вариант для новичков. Позволяют быстро получить нужную информацию, не вникая в тонкости языка запросов. 👶
  • Запросы с параметрами: делают ваши запросы более гибкими и интерактивными. Представьте, что вы можете задавать условия выборки прямо во время выполнения запроса! 🪄
  • Сложные запросы: позволяют комбинировать данные из разных таблиц, выполнять сложные вычисления и решать самые нетривиальные задачи. 🧙‍♂️

Консоль запросов: ваш полигон для экспериментов 🧪

Консоль запросов — это незаменимый инструмент для разработчиков и опытных пользователей 1С. Здесь можно:

  • Тестировать запросы: прежде чем встраивать запрос в код, его можно проверить и отладить в консоли. 🐞
  • Анализировать производительность: консоль позволяет увидеть, сколько времени занимает выполнение запроса и оптимизировать его при необходимости. ⏱️
  • Экспериментировать с синтаксисом языка запросов: консоль — это отличное место для того, чтобы изучать новые возможности языка запросов и оттачивать свои навыки. 👨‍💻

Язык запросов 1С: разговор с базой данных на «ты» 🗣️

Язык запросов 1С — это ваш способ общения с базой данных. Он достаточно прост в освоении, но при этом обладает широкими возможностями. Основные элементы языка запросов:

  • Операторы: определяют действия, которые нужно выполнить с данными (выбрать, отсортировать, сгруппировать и т.д.).
  • Функции: позволяют выполнять вычисления, работать с датами, строками и другими типами данных.
  • Логические операторы (AND, OR, NOT): позволяют комбинировать условия выборки и получать более точные результаты.

План запроса: заглядываем под капот ⚙️

План запроса — это визуальное представление того, как 1С будет получать данные из базы. Анализ плана запроса позволяет:

  • Понять, как работает запрос: увидеть, какие таблицы будут задействованы, в каком порядке будут выполняться операции.
  • Оптимизировать запросы: найти «узкие места» и ускорить получение данных.

& vs &&: в чем разница? 🤔

В языке запросов 1С, как и во многих других языках программирования, есть два оператора логического "И": & и &&. В чем же их различие?

  • &: оператор безусловного логического "И". Он всегда вычисляет оба операнда, даже если результат первого операнда уже определил итоговое значение выражения.
  • &&: оператор условного логического "И". Он вычисляет второй операнд только в том случае, если результат первого операнда истинный. Это позволяет повысить производительность кода, так как во многих случаях нет необходимости вычислять второй операнд.

Заключение: запросы — ваш ключ к успеху в мире 1С 🏆

Умение работать с запросами — это один из ключевых навыков для любого специалиста, работающего с 1С. Запросы открывают безграничные возможности для анализа данных, автоматизации бизнес-процессов и принятия взвешенных решений. Не бойтесь экспериментировать, изучайте язык запросов, и вы сможете использовать всю мощь 1С на благо своего бизнеса! 🚀

FAQ: часто задаваемые вопросы о запросах в 1С ❓

  • Что такое запрос в 1С?

Запрос в 1С — это механизм, который позволяет получать и обрабатывать данные из базы данных.

  • Зачем нужны запросы в 1С?

Запросы нужны для выборки данных по заданным критериям, обработки информации, формирования отчетов и многого другого.

  • Какие виды запросов есть в 1С?

В 1С есть простые запросы, запросы с параметрами и сложные запросы.

  • Что такое консоль запросов?

Консоль запросов — это инструмент для тестирования, отладки и анализа производительности запросов.

  • Что такое язык запросов 1С?

Язык запросов 1С — это специальный язык, который используется для написания запросов к базе данных.

  • Что такое план запроса?

План запроса — это визуальное представление того, как 1С будет получать данные из базы.

Вверх